Ceramic membrane crossflow filtration for yeast recovery and beer sterilization.

In the beer production process, filtration and sterilization are required. The purpose of filtration is to remove yeast cells and other turbid substances in the beer during the fermentation process, such as hop resin, tannin, yeast, lactic acid bacteria, protein and other impurities, so as to improve the transparency of the beer and improve the aroma and taste of the beer. The purpose of sterilization is to remove yeast, microorganisms and bacteria, terminate fermentation reaction, ensure safe drinking of beer and prolong shelf life. At present, membrane separation technology for filtration and sterilization of beer has become a new trend. Membrane separation technology used in beer production can not only fully retain the flavor and nutrition of beer, but also improve the clarity of beer. The draft beer filtered by the inorganic membrane basically maintains the flavor of the fresh beer, the hop aroma, bitterness and retention performance are basically unaffected, while the turbidity is significantly reduced, generally below 0.5 turbidity units, and the bacterial retention rate is close to 100%. However, because the filter membrane cannot withstand too high filtration pressure difference, there is almost no adsorption effect, so the wine liquid is required to be well pre-filtered to remove large particles and macromolecular colloidal substances. At present, enterprises are generally applying microporous membrane filtration technology to the production process of making draft beer.

Microfiltration membrane filtration technology is mainly used in the following three aspects in beer production:
1. Reform the traditional filtration process. The traditional filtration process is that the fermentation broth is coarsely filtered through diatomaceous earth and then finely filtered through cardboard. Now, membrane filtration can be used to replace cardboard fine filtration, and the membrane filtration effect is better, and the quality of the filtered wine is higher.
2. Pasteurization and high temperature instantaneous sterilization are common methods to improve the quality period of beer. Now this method can be replaced by microfiltration membrane technology. This is because the pore size of the filter membrane selected in the filtration process is enough to prevent microorganisms from passing through, so as to remove polluting microorganisms and residual yeast in beer, so as to improve the shelf life of beer. Because membrane filtration avoids the damage of high temperature to the taste and nutrition of fresh beer, the beer produced has a purer taste, which is commonly known as “fresh beer”.
3. Beer is a highly seasonal consumer drink. Demand is particularly high in summer and autumn. In order to meet the needs of the market, many manufacturers use the post-dilution method of high-concentration fermentation broth to rapidly expand production. The quality of sterile water and CO2 gas necessary for post-dilution of beer is directly related to the quality of beer. The CO2 required for the production of breweries is usually directly recovered from the fermenter, pressed into “dry ice” and then used. It has almost no treatment, So that impurity content is high. The sterile water filtration required for post-dilution is commonly used with ordinary depth filter materials, and it is generally difficult to meet the requirements of sterile water. The emergence of membrane filtration technology is a good solution for manufacturers to solve this problem. In the water treated by the membrane filter, the number of Escherichia coli and all kinds of miscellaneous bacteria are basically removed. After the CO2 gas is processed by the membrane filter, the purity can reach more than 95%. All these processes provide a reliable guarantee for improving the quality of wine.

The use of membrane separation technology can effectively sterilize wine, remove turbidity, reduce alcohol concentration, significantly improve the clarity of wine, maintain the color, aroma and taste of raw wine, and prolong the shelf life of wine.
